The CDC offers parenting videos in English and Spanish, aimed primarily at parents of young children. Here you’ll find videos of the positive parenting skills. For each topic, there are two types of videos:

  • Feature Video of Real-life Parenting Challenges
    Have you ever been frustrated that your child doesn’t listen or struggled with how to handle specific behaviors?  See how parents like you address every day challenges and find real world solutions.
  • “How-To” Video of Expert Tips and Ideas
    Do you want to know the steps for time-out or how to set family rules? These videos have specific “how-to’s” for positive parenting. Experts provide tips and ideas that are direct and to-the-point.

Children’s Hospital at Vanderbilt: Play Nicely: The Healthy Discipline Program : This is a brief, population-based intervention designed to prevent violence and mitigate toxic stress. Rates of violence and other health problems could be reduced if all caregivers learned how to respond to the following question appropriately: “Assume you see one young child hit another. What are you going to do?” Watch the videos.

American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P): Discipline Strategies: AAP shares ways to help teach your children acceptable behavior as they grow with its 10 Healthy Discipline Strategies That Work.
